This section looks at the demand for Worldwide Web Consortium (W3C) skills within the City of London region with a comparison to our Miscellaneous category. Included is a guide to the contractor rates offered in IT jobs that have cited W3C over the 3 months to 25 July 2008 with a comparison to the same period last year.

We calculate average IT contractor rates directly from the figures quoted and do not attempt to derive hourly rates from daily rates or vice versa.
